Rack-A-TACC Rack Mounted Password Decryption Device
Rack-A-TACC units integrate four accelerators into a single 2U chassis controlled by a quad core host computer with optimised I/O channels. This design allows the appliance to be used as an individual stand alone system for breaking passwords or to be integrated into a distributed network for increased scalability and performance.
Rack-A-TACC Baseline Specifications
- Core 2 Duo Dual Core / Quad Core Motherboard with Intel® Q45 & ICH10DO System Chipset and 1333/1066/800 MHz Front Side Bus
- Intel Core 2 Quad Q9400 Quad-Core Processor 2.66GHz, 1333FSB, LGA775, 6MB cache [T1010]
- 4 GB DDR3-1066 Dual Channel Memory [T2000]
- Intel® Q45 Integrated Gen 5.0 GMA 4500 Graphics Controller with Single Monitor Output (1 port VGA)
- Dual 10/100/1000 Mbs Gigabit Ethernet Network Adapters
- High Definition Audio Controller
- 4 port, 3.0 Gb/s Serial ATA (SATA Controller
- 7 USB 2.0/1.x ports - 4 Back Mounted, 3 Front Mounted (1 Write Blocked)
- 1 FireWire IEEE 1394b (800 MB/s) port
- 500GB 7200 RPM 3.0Gb/s SATA Hard Drive (Internal System Drive)
- Software includes: Windows 7 Ultimate (64 bit) with XP Mode [T0003] Also includes: Windows XP Professional (32 bit), DOS (Win98 Standalone), Norton Ghost, CD Authoring Software, DRIVESPY, IMAGE, PDWIPE, PART, and PDBLOCK
- Four (4) Tableau TACC1441 Password Accelerator units
